There are two ways of adding an instruction step to a work instruction: manually and using Multi-Line Import. Here’s how to do it:
Adding an Instruction Step Manually #
- Navigate to the work instruction where you would like to add an instruction step.
- Click on “Add instruction step”.
- Type in the instruction step description.
To add another instruction step, simply repeat the steps above.
Adding an Instruction Step Using Multi-Line Import #
What Is Multi-Line Import? #
Azumuta has a time-saving feature: Multi-Line Import. It allows you to copy text from another document and paste it into an Azumuta work instruction.
Our platform will then automatically transform this text into work instruction steps. Thus, you don’t have to manually type in the instruction steps on your own.
How Do You Use Multi-Line Import? #
Before you follow the steps below, make sure that you’ve already copied the text that you would like to import into your work instruction.
- Navigate to the work instruction where you would like to use Multi-Line Import.
- Click on the three-dot icon (“More actions”).
- Click on “Add from multi-line text…”.
- Paste it to the existing field.
- Click on “Next”.
- Check whether the automatically generated instruction steps are correct. You can also delete instruction steps there (if desired).
- Click on “Add instruction steps”.
